The #parlicovidmemorialquilt project aims:
We wanted there to be a clear driving force behind the quilt's creation. We developed the four c’s to act as the thread running through, & joining, the entire project. These 4 c’s are: Create, Connect, Convey, Commemorate.

Here are the first 64 patchwork blocks all sewn together! These patchwork blocks are being pieced together to create a lasting textile memorial of the Pandemic that represents the multitude of experiences within Parliament whilst also demonstrating unity through a single quilt.
